Hi Annette! Been busy out in the garden lately and don't have as much time for the computer :) (Don't always check Chit Chat either)
I live in New Brunswick - fairly close to Saint John and go there often to shop! I'm originally from Ontario and don't consider myself a true maritimer yet ;)
 I'd say that we have 5 good gardening months but maybe only 3 months for hardy lily blooms. I'm jealous of your year round gardening weather! Some winters we don't get snow until mid Jan. and we get a lot of freeze/thaw cycles that are really hard on the plants :( The ski hills in NB would be out of business if not for snow making machines

If you have the room,make another ledge just below the water line and place rock on that. Then place more rock to cover the first layer until you are up to ground level. The only problem is that it takes lots of rock! I think Cliff and Joann's site explains it better.

Here is a pic of my pond that sort of shows what I mean.
